Excerpt of message (sent 15 March 2002) by Mallikarjun C.:
> I agree with Julian.
>
> Seems to me that targets should be allowed to ask for an ack
> on the last Data-In PDU that concludes the entire transfer for the
> task - a follow-up NOP-ping is needless. I propose that we
>
> replace:
> "it MAY set the A bit to 1 only once every MaxBurstSize bytes and MUST NOT do so more frequently than this."
>
> with:
> "it MAY set the A bit to 1 only once every MaxBurstSize bytes or on the last
> Data-In PDU that concludes the entire requested transfer from the target's
> perspective, and MUST NOT do so more frequently than this."
Sounds good to me. As far as I can tell, this matches the intent of
what Eddy and Kevin were talking about.
